IccMAX 2.1.27
Color Profile Tools
Loading...
Searching...
No Matches
IccTagLut.h File Reference
#include "IccTagBasic.h"
+ Include dependency graph for IccTagLut.h:
+ This graph shows which files directly or indirectly include this file:

Go to the source code of this file.

Data Structures

class  CIccApplyCLUT
 
class  CIccCLUT
 
class  CIccCurve
 
class  CIccMatrix
 
class  CIccMBB
 
class  CIccTagCurve
 
class  CIccTagGamutBoundaryDesc
 
class  CIccTagLut16
 
class  CIccTagLut8
 
class  CIccTagLutAtoB
 
class  CIccTagLutBtoA
 
class  CIccTagParametricCurve
 
class  CIccTagSegmentedCurve
 
struct  icGamutBoundaryTriangle
 
class  IIccCLUTExec
 

Typedefs

typedef icFloatNumber(* icCLUTCLIPFUNC) (icFloatNumber v)
 
typedef CIccCurveLPIccCurve
 

Enumerations

enum  icTagCurveSizeInit { icInitNone , icInitZero , icInitIdentity }
 

Detailed Description

File: IccTagLut.h

Contains: Header for implementation of the Multi-Dimensional Lut tag classes classes

Version: V1

Copyright: � see ICC Software License

Definition in file IccTagLut.h.


Data Structure Documentation

◆ icGamutBoundaryTriangle

struct icGamutBoundaryTriangle
Data Fields
icUInt32Number m_VertexNumbers[3]

Typedef Documentation

◆ icCLUTCLIPFUNC

typedef icFloatNumber(* icCLUTCLIPFUNC) (icFloatNumber v)

◆ LPIccCurve

Enumeration Type Documentation

◆ icTagCurveSizeInit

Enumerator
icInitNone 
icInitZero 
icInitIdentity 
114 {
icTagCurveSizeInit
Definition IccTagLut.h:114
@ icInitZero
Definition IccTagLut.h:116
@ icInitIdentity
Definition IccTagLut.h:117
@ icInitNone
Definition IccTagLut.h:115